ARGdov 13 July 11, 2014 Share July 11, 2014 I'm a bit confused by the nature of what the wonderbolts are as a organisation. In Friendship is Magic, it is stated that they are the greatest flying team in equestria. This seems to imply that there are other flying teams, which is fine. But in Sweet and Elite, Rarity attends a wonderbolts derby, which is basically a horse race, but it features more than the 3 'main' wonderbolts, which seems to imply it's some sort of league. But then in Secret of my Excess they are shown to have some sort of military function, which is backed up by the episodes Wonderbolts Academy and Testing, Testing,123. Shanks 10,816 July 12, 2014 Share July 12, 2014 The Wonderbolts are based on the Blue Angels which are a division of the Navy which are known for putting on shows similar to the Wonderbolts. Cwanky 17,661 July 12, 2014 Share July 12, 2014 What Earthbendingprodigy said is just about spot on. Functionally the Wonderbolts are a division of what would be the equivalent of the US Navy or Air Force. Since they are part of the military and their role includes defending Equestria, they can also, at least some of their members, be considered part of the reserve or national guard as we see them acting in Secret of My Excess hopelessly trying to fight off a giant Spike. Considering the poor track record of the Wonderbolts though and the Equestrian Royal Guard and Army as a whole, one would have to think Equestria has a very poor defense. Their supposed leader, Spitfire, has a very questionable integrity and moral fitness not to mention lack of leadership, and Celestia and Luna in turn seem to always be absent at the worst times, which leads the Royal Army to flounder with no apparent general, since Shining Armor moved to the Crystal Empire. Admiral Regulus 2,769 July 13, 2014 Share July 13, 2014 (edited) I always thought of the Wonderbolts as the equivalent of the Blue Angels, as well. They're part of the military in the same way that the Blue Angels are part of the US Navy, but they're really more for show than anything else. I guess you could consider them like an elite squadron. Orablanco Account 3,707 July 15, 2014 Share July 15, 2014 Best as I can guess, the Wonderbolts were founded to serve as a military force, but seeing as how Equestria hasn't seen any wars or anything requiring military action outside of a changeling invasion or the odd dragon attack in quite some time (as far as we know), the group probably morphed into the Blue Angels-esque show team we know them as now. 2 Onwards to my DeviantArt page!
